There was a famine in the land, so Abram went down to Egypt to stay for a while because the famine was severe. As he approached Egypt, he said to his wife Sarai, “Look, I know that you are a beautiful woman. When the Egyptians see you they will say, ‘This is his wife.’ Then they will kill me but will keep you alive.  So tell them you are my sister so that it may go well for me because of you and my life will be spared on account of you.”  Genesis 12:10-13

The above passage is part of the text from today’s sermon.  This passage represents the struggles and difficulties of life that tempt us to follow our own way rather than God’s way.  Abram need not fear his death.  God had not yet fulfilled His promise of an heir to him yet.  God certainly would protect Abram so as to keep His promise.  We need to remember to choose God’s way is always the best.  Remember, Hagar came up from Egypt with them.  If Sarai had not been in Pharaoh’s house they may never have had Hagar to deal with.  Please pray with us concerning learning to trust in  God’s way of doing things over our own.
